5 Terminology
5.1 Abbreviations and Acronyms
5.1.1 FPD — Flat Panel Display
5.1.2 PPE — Personal Protective Equipment
5.1.3 SSCC — Safety Supervisors’ Communication Council
5.2 Definitions
5.2.1 Definitions in SEMI S2, SEMI S19 and SEMI S21 are incorporated herein by reference, unless the term is
defined within this section.
5.2.2 abnormality — a condition or behavior different from normal or predetermined state that can result in an
incident or accident.
5.2.3 adjacent work area — a work area that shares a common boundary with the work area being considered. The
common boundary may separate the areas horizontally (e.g., the areas are on opposite sides of a wall) or vertically
(e.g., one work area is in a cleanroom and the other in the subfab directly underneath it).
5.2.4 contractor — a company hired to accomplish a contractually specified scope of work, such as constructing a
facility or providing service.
5.2.5 de-installation — the process of disconnecting, disassembling, and moving semiconductor or FPD
manufacturing equipment from its point of installation, including movement of assemblies and further preparation
(e.g., isolating, decontaminating, component disposal) of chemically contaminated semiconductor or FPD
manufacturing equipment for a safe move.
5.2.6 equipment supplier — party who provides equipment to and communicates directly with the user. A supplier
may be a manufacturer, an equipment distributor, or an equipment representative.
5.2.7 fab — a facility in which semiconductor devices or flat panel displays are manufactured.
5.2.8 facility supplier — party who provides a facility or facility service (e.g., nitrogen) to, and directly
communicates with, the user. A facility supplier may be a construction company, a manufacturer or distributor of
facility equipment (e.g., deionization systems), or a facility service provider.
5.2.9
installation — the activities performed after the equipment is received at a user site through preparation for
initial service, including transportation, lifting, uncrating, placement, leveling, and facilities fit up. [SEMI S8]
5.2.10 multi-employer fab — a fab in which employees of more than one company work. The workers may or may
not be present at the same time for a fab to be considered “multi-employer”.

5.2.11 multi-employer work area — a work area in which employees of more than one company work. The workers
may or may not be present at the same time for an area to be considered “multi-employer”.
5.2.12 overhaul — major disassembly, replacement of components as necessary, and reassembly.
5.2.13 start-up — the initial energization of semiconductor or FPD manufacturing equipment from each source of
energy that may introduce a hazard to the semiconductor or FPD manufacturing equipment itself, the persons
performing the installation, or the facility.
5.2.14 supplier — an equipment supplier or facility supplier.
5.2.15 unit of work — the extent of work which is directly controllable by a supervisor.
5.2.16 user — party who acquires equipment for the purpose of using it to manufacture semiconductors or FPDs.
5.2.17 work area — room or defined space where semiconductor or FPD manufacturing equipment is located and
where workers are present. This can include service chases and sub-fab areas.
5.2.18 work supervisor — person who manages workers directly as a team leader to conduct a unit of work.
6 General Concepts
6.1 The users, suppliers and contractors should reduce risks in their own tasks and have their people work safely.
6.2 The user should coordinate the work schedules of the suppliers and the contractors who work simultaneously in
the multi-employer and adjacent work areas.
6.2.1 The user should explain to each supplier or contractor how to communicate unexpected schedule changes to
the affected parties.
6.2.2 Each supplier or contractor should submit a work schedule through whole tasks before starting an initial task.
The supplier or contractor should submit a revised schedule to the user at every update.
6.2.3 Based on the work schedule, the user should provide the necessary safety information such as PPE, safety
alarms, evacuation route, and safety devices (safety net, eye shower, fall protection, etc.) to its employees and to the
affected suppliers and contractors.
7 User Actions
7.1 The user should provide the safe working environment for all people who work in its fab. In order to do so, the
user should also encourage mutual communication among the suppliers and contractors.
7.1.1 Safety Management Plan Notification — Based on the work process, work schedule, and facility layout plan,
the user should disclose the safety management plan during the installation/overhaul and startup period including
such items as fundamental policy of safety management, target, and important points of hazard prevention.
7.1.2 Provision of safety net and anchorage (hookup facility) point for personal fall protection equipment (safety
harnesses) should be included in the safety management plan.
7.2 The user should establish a
Safety Supervisors’ Communication Council (SSCC).
7.3 The user should conduct a SSCC meeting in which representatives of the user and all the suppliers and the
contractors should participate. The suppliers and the contractors should attend the SSCC meeting each workday.
7.4 The user should coordinate the suppliers’ and the contractors’ workers to work together safely.
7.5 When the workers of different companies conduct work separately in the upper and lower rooms of the same
area, they should communicate each other and coordinate their work before and during the work, under the
leadership of the user.
7.6 At work locations where the workers may face hazards, relevant work supervisors should communicate well
and coordinate with each other for the work under the leadership of the user.
7.7 The user should instruct the suppliers’ and the contractors’ workers so that their tasks should be carried out after
setting up incident/accident preventive facilities and preparing PPE.

8 Work Supervisor
8.1 Each supplier should designate a responsible person, called “work supervisor”, as a representative of the
supplier for each unit of work.
8.2 The work supervisor should also communicate with the user and other work supervisors and make efforts to
reduce the risk to the employees of all of the employers.
8.3 The work supervisor should make himself/herself identifiable by others by wearing an identifying item, such as
colored cap, colored band, or badge.
NOTE 2: We recommend identification method is consistent for all supervisors at the given site.
8.4 When the work supervisor leaves the workplace, he/she should transfer his/her responsibility to his/her
substitute.
8.5 Tasks of the Work Supervisor — The work supervisor should:
8.5.1 Attend the SSCC meeting.
8.5.2 Present the instructions from the SSCC meeting and safety patrol results to the workers.
8.5.3 Adjust each work schedule with the user and other suppliers or contractors and identify hazardous areas and
restricted areas in multi-employer work areas.
8.5.4 Identify the hazardous and restricted areas to the workers.
8.5.5 Conduct a job hazard analysis before work and share the results with all the workers in order to awaken their
awareness to hazards and to encourage them to take proper measures.
8.5.6 Put up warning indications identified by SSCC.
8.5.7 Conduct safety patrol on the workplace and observe the adjacent workareas. For avoiding Intellectual
Property problems, the SSCC meeting should deal with Intellectual Property issues.
8.5.8 In case of equipment trouble affecting an adjacent work area, notify the user and people working there of the
abnormality
.
NOTE 3: The following 14 additional tasks are recommended for consideration.
Prepare a work instruction on the basis of work schedule and notify the workers of it.
Visually inspect the user cleanroom and its associated facilities as well as all of the plant before starting to
work.
Check facilities for eyewash, shower, anchorage, fire fighting and emergency evacuation.
Give work instruction to workers after confirming that no unsafe condition exists around the workplace.
Allocate workers properly in terms of manpower, skill level, prioritization of units of work, schedule, etc., so
that the risks should be appropriately managed.
Carry out arrangement and inspection of tools and jigs and PPE to be used.
Check if workers are physically able to do a task.
Give instruction to the relevant worker and have him/her correct it on the spot, whenever unsafe behavior or
situation is witnessed.
Conduct housekeeping and make due preparation for the next day.
Report work progress status to the user as well as to the superior of the work supervisor.
Consult with his/her superior and the user in case an incident or accident happens.
